Regulation (EU) 2016/429 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 9 March 2016 on transmissible animal diseases and amending and repealing certain acts in the area of animal health (‘Animal Health Law’) (Text with EEA relevance)

article  124

CELEX:  02016R0429-20210421

General requirements for movements of kept terrestrial animals Operators shall take appropriate preventive measures to ensure that the movement of kept terrestrial animals does not jeopardise the health status at the place of destination with regard to: the listed diseases referred to in point (d) of Article 9(1); emerging diseases. Operators shall only move kept terrestrial animals from their establishments and receive such animals if the animals in question fulfil the following conditions: they come from establishments that have been: registered by the competent authority in accordance with Article 93; or approved by the competent authority in accordance with Articles 97(1) and 98, when required by Article 94(1) or Article 95; or granted a derogation from the registration requirement laid down in Article 84; they fulfil the identification and registration requirements laid down in Articles 112, 113, 114, 115 and 117 and the rules adopted pursuant to Articles 118 and 120.
